Description

Office.com is one of the largest multilingual content driven web-sites in the world. With more than 1 billion visits per year, it reaches 40 languages. For the Office 2010 release, authoring and publishing for Office.com was changed to make use of Microsoft Word and SharePoint. A large migration effort was undertaken to move 5 million+ assets for 40 markets to new file formats and management systems. In this talk we will present lessons learnt for designing and managing multilingual web-sites from this major re-engineering exercise.
